Sensory and central mechanisms control intersegmental coordination

Curr Opin Neurobiol. 2001 Dec;11(6):678-83. doi: 10.1016/s0959-4388(01)00268-9.

Abstract

Recent experiments on the sensory and central mechanisms that coordinate animal locomotory movements have advanced our understanding of the relative importance of these two components and overturned some previously held notions. In different experimental preparations, sensory inputs and central pattern generators have now been shown to play different roles in setting intersegmental phase lags.
